The Numbers Behind the Success: Record-Breaking On-Site Sales
Held from March 4 to 7, 2026, at the World Trade Centre Kuala Lumpur (WTCKL) and the Malaysia International Trade & Exhibition Centre (MITEC), the fair recorded an impressive estimated transaction volume of US$1.24 billion in on-site sales.
Key figures from the event highlight an unprecedented global reach:
- 643 exhibitors from 11 countries and regions (including China, Japan, Turkiye, and Korea)
- 18,402 unique visitors arriving from 123 different nations
- 100,000 square meters of total exhibition space across 17 halls
The massive influx of buyers from the United States, Canada, Australia, India, and Singapore demonstrates how the stability and competitiveness of the Malaysian furniture industry continue to attract major global players.

What’s New in 2026: Sustainability, Lifestyle, and Young Talents
MIFF 2026 non è stata solo una piattaforma di scambio commerciale, ma un vero e proprio incubatore di tendenze e innovazione.
Among the most popular additions to this edition was the debut of The Muse Hall (at WTCKL), an area entirely dedicated to lifestyle and home décor. Significant attention was also dedicated to the green transition with the ENERtec roadshow, which focused on renewable energy and sustainable (ESG) practices for furniture manufacturers.
Cutting-edge design was highlighted through:
- Furniture Excellence Awards: accolades presented to products seamlessly integrating smart tech, modularity, and multipurpose usability.
- The SELECTS: Origins 1.0: a highly successful collaborative initiative pairing emerging local designers with Malaysian manufacturers, blending world-class creativity with industrial processes.
